Soccer club burglar leaves police offside

A man attempted to break into a western suburbs soccer club before returning in the dead of night to target a vending machine.

Hobsons Bay police have released CCTV of then attempted burglary at Altona Magic Soccer Club on Mills St last month.

Police say a man tried to gain access to the club rooms via a side door about 11.50am before he fled on a blue motorbike.

It is believed the same man returned later that night, about 9pm, before he broke into a vending machine outside an undercover area.

The man stole an unknown amount of cash and fled the scene.

Investigators have released images and CCTV of a man they believe can assist with their investigation.
